Does EA own other companies?

EA also owns and operates major gaming studios such as EA Tiburon in Orlando, EA Vancouver in Burnaby, EA Romania in Bucharest, DICE in Stockholm, Motive Studio in Montreal, BioWare in Edmonton and Austin, and Respawn Entertainment in Los Angeles and Vancouver.

Does EA own Ubisoft?

Of the six companies which EA purchased a stake in, two remaining companies are based in the U.S., while three other U.S. companies are defunct. After acquiring a 19.9% stake in France-based Ubisoft in 2004, EA sold a remaining 14.8% stake in it in 2010.

What is EA's biggest game?

The Sims 4 was a juggernaut for EA in 2022, with players collectively logging 1.4 billion hours in the game. Players created more than 436.5 million Sims, while 21.7 million Sims perished (the most common death was old age, followed by anger and then drowning).

Does EA own Star Wars?

Star Wars games have gone through three significant development eras: early licensed games (1979–1993), games developed after the creation of LucasArts (1993–2013), and games created after the closure of LucasArts (2014–present), which are currently licensed to Electronic Arts, and include an EA Star Wars logo.

Does EA own Sims?

The Sims is a series of life simulation video games developed by Maxis and published by Electronic Arts. The franchise has sold nearly 200 million copies worldwide, and it is one of the best-selling video game series of all time.

Does EA still own origin?

In 2020, EA merged its EA Access and Origin Access Basic subscription services together into one, which became EA Play. It also renamed Origin Access Premier to EA Play Pro.

Is EA losing Star Wars?

No, Electronic Arts (EA) does not own Star Wars. Rather, EA signed a 10-year deal in 2013 that allowed EA exclusive game making rights, meaning EA and only EA could make Star Wars themed games until 2023.

What company owns Assassin's Creed?

Assassin's Creed is an open-world, action-adventure, and stealth game franchise published by Ubisoft and developed mainly by its studio Ubisoft Montreal using the game engine Anvil and its more advanced derivatives.

What is the #1 game ever?

1. Tetris – 520 million. Arguably the most timeless video game ever created, Tetris sits comfortably atop the list of all-time bestsellers with 520 million copies sold, according to The Tetris Company.
